Background
The sweeping robot can autonomously sweep an area, so that the manpower required to be consumed in cleaning is greatly reduced. The sweeping robot traverses the area to be cleaned through map navigation drawn by self, in the actual working process, the material placement of the area to be cleaned is complex, the travel of the sweeping robot is easy to be interfered, in the working process, the sweeping robot needs to enter a wall-following mode to completely clean the corner area of the area to be cleaned, or a self-recharging seat is charged, in the process, the sweeping robot transmits signals through a signal transmitter and receives wall return signals, the sweeping robot travels in a manner of keeping parallel to and attached to the wall according to the signals returned by the wall, therefore, in the state of along the wall, the sweeping robot has a probability of traveling to the vicinity of a columnar obstacle near the wall due to interference deviation along the wall route, the columnar obstacle is identified as the wall, the column-following travel is trapped, typical trapped scenes comprise thicker table legs, stools, sofa feet supports, clothes hangers, flower shelves and the like, if the column-following is formed in the environment, the sweeping robot continuously moves around the column in the state of along the wall, and thus the area to be cleaned can not normally.
Disclosure of Invention
The embodiment of the application aims at providing a scheme for controlling a sweeping robot to automatically identify a winding column and get rid of the trapping state under the state of winding the column.
In order to solve the technical problems, the embodiment of the application provides a robot winding post escaping method, which adopts the following technical scheme:
the robot post winding escaping method comprises the following steps:
continuously recording coordinates and an advancing direction angle of the sweeping robot in a cleaning area in a wall-following state;
if the sweeping robot repeatedly runs on the already-passed coordinates, marking the current coordinates as detection coordinates and entering a monitoring state;
in the monitoring state, if the sweeping robot repeatedly runs on the already-passed coordinates, entering a recovery state;
in a recovery state, controlling the sweeping robot to run to a detection coordinate, and controlling the sweeping robot to walk reversely along the coordinate before the sweeping robot runs to the detection coordinate for the first time according to the continuously recorded coordinate until collision occurs;
and updating the detection coordinates according to the current coordinates, recovering to a wall-following state, and if the sweeping robot repeatedly operates on the detection coordinates within a preset operation distance, entering a monitoring state until the sweeping robot does not repeatedly operate within the preset operation distance in the wall-following state, and emptying the detection coordinates.

Further, the step S200: if the sweeping robot repeatedly runs on the already-passed coordinates, marking the current coordinates as detection coordinates and entering a monitoring state, wherein the method specifically comprises the following steps:
step S201: according to the repeated occurrence of the sweeping robot on one coordinate, acquiring the angle change quantity of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ot between the two occurrences of the sweeping robot on the coordinate;
step S204: determining that the sweeping robot winds a column according to the angle change quantity of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ot is a circle;
step S205: the current coordinates are marked as detection coordinates and a monitoring state is entered.
Specifically, in a wall-following state in a small area, such as a recess formed by a relatively close distance between the bearing post and the wall in some rooms. Under the condition that the coordinate precision used for navigation is limited, the sweeping robot can repeatedly pass through the same coordinate in the process of passing along the wall, at the moment, whether the sweeping robot is trapped around a column can be accurately distinguished by firstly judging that the sweeping robot repeatedly runs on the same coordinate and secondly judging that the sweeping robot passes through the same coordinate twice, and if the sweeping robot winds around the column, the sweeping robot is driven to rotate at least one circle in an accumulated mode when the sweeping robot passes through the same coordinate twice.
Further, the step S201: according to the repeated occurrence of the sweeping robot on one of the coordinates, after the change amount of the advancing direction angle of the sweeping robot between the two occurrences of the sweeping robot on the coordinates is obtained, step S204: determining that the sweeping robot winds before a column according to the change of the angle of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ot as one circle;
step S202: according to the wall-following direction of the sweeping robot, determining that the angle change direction of the robot when the robot winds a column is clockwise or anticlockwise;
step S203: and determining that the angle change quantity is matched with the angle change direction of the robot when the robot winds the column according to the angle change quantity of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ot.
For a cleaning area with a narrow part of outlets, the sweeping robot enters the area, goes along the wall, and then leaves the cleaning area from the outlet, so that misjudgment about a column may occur, for example, if the wall is at the left side of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ot, the sweeping robot rotates anticlockwise when the sweeping robot winds the column, and the sweeping robot detected by the gyroscope rotates anticlockwise; also, the wall is at the left side of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ot, and if the sweeping robot rotates clockwise, it means that the sweeping robot moves along the wall around an area instead of the column even if the sweeping robot rotates by one turn. For this case, first, the direction of the sweeping robot along the wall is determined, in one embodiment, the wall is on the left side of the advancing direction of the sweeping robot, then when the sweeping robot repeatedly operates at the same coordinates and the gyroscope rotates for one circle in an accumulated manner, the direction of the change seen by the sweeping robot is determined, if the sweeping robot rotates in the clockwise direction, it is stated that the sweeping robot normally walks along the wall in the cleaning area with a narrow outlet, and only if the sweeping robot accumulates for one circle in the anticlockwise rotation, the sweeping robot is trapped around the column. The scheme is favorable for accurately identifying whether the sweeping robot is trapped around the column.
